In discussions of sleep cycles, the 90-minute sleep cycle is a crucial concept for sleep lovers and those looking for a far better understanding of their remainder patterns. Human sleep commonly proceeds via numerous phases throughout the night, and one full cycle generally lasts around 90 minutes. Within this cycle, individuals move through light sleep, deep sleep, and REM sleep.

For those wanting to determine their sleep cycles efficiently, a 90-minute sleep cycle calculator can be an important tool. These calculators usually think about the moment a person aims to sleep and recommend optimum wake times based on the 90-minute cycle. By allowing users to make these estimations, they can much better navigate through their resting patterns, guaranteeing they don't wake throughout deep sleep phases, which can cause grogginess and headaches. If you discover on your own often getting up with a headache after a nap, you're not alone, as this is an usual incident and can originate from several factors. One prospective reason for post-nap headaches is sleep inertia, the duration of grogginess you experience upon waking from deep sleep. Around 20 to 30 minutes-- you may really feel disoriented and experience a headache upon waking if you overshoot the ideal nap period-- ideally. If you typically take naps throughout the day, these heady after-effects can be much more obvious, particularly if your naps interrupt core sleep later in the evening. The top quality of your nap can also be impacted by the sleep problems, such as lights, noise, and your positioning. Hydration levels and high levels of caffeine intake before a nap can influence your body's action and might lead to headaches.
